file-type

Android8.0双WiFi模式开发:STA+AP技术解析

版权申诉
5星 · 超过95%的资源 | 262KB | 更新于2024-12-23 | 158 浏览量 | 22 下载量 举报 4 收藏
download 限时特惠:#14.90
知识点一:Android8.0平台概述 Android8.0是Google发布的第14个版本的Android系统,相较于上一个版本,其在性能、安全性和用户体验等方面都有了显著的提升。在双wifi模块STA+AP模式下,Android8.0能够同时作为STA(Station)和AP(Access Point)进行工作,即设备既能够连接到其他无线网络,也能够创建一个无线网络供其他设备连接。 知识点二:STA模式 STA模式是无线网络中最常见的工作模式,即客户端模式。在这个模式下,设备可以连接到其他的无线接入点,通过该接入点访问网络。在Android设备中,STA模式通常用于浏览网页、收发邮件等网络活动。 知识点三:AP模式 AP模式,也称作热点模式或服务器模式,可以使Android设备转变成一个无线路由器。在此模式下,其他设备可以通过Android设备连接到网络。AP模式常用于移动网络共享、临时网络环境搭建等场景。 知识点四:双wifi模块STA+AP模式的实现 在Android8.0平台上实现双wifi模块STA+AP模式,需要对wifi模块进行编程控制,使其能够在STA模式和AP模式之间切换,或者同时支持两种模式。这通常需要对Android的wifi framework进行深入的理解和开发。 知识点五:wifi framework开发 wifi framework是Android系统中管理wifi连接和服务的组件。它为开发者提供了丰富的接口和工具,用于实现wifi连接的管理、网络状态的监听、网络配置的修改等功能。在双wifi模块STA+AP模式的实现中,开发者需要使用wifi framework提供的API进行模块的控制和管理。 知识点六:wificond_new、wificond、wifi_new、wifi文件 这些文件可能是Android wifi模块的核心组件,负责实现wifi连接和管理的控制逻辑。在Android8.0平台上,开发者可能需要修改这些文件,或者使用其中的函数和类,来实现双wifi模块STA+AP模式的功能。具体的修改和使用方式,需要结合Android wifi framework的开发文档和源代码进行深入研究。 知识点七:Android开发 在Android平台上进行开发,需要具备Java或Kotlin语言的基础,熟悉Android SDK的使用,了解Android系统的架构和组件。在实现双wifi模块STA+AP模式的开发中,还需要对Android的wifi框架有深入的理解和掌握。 知识点八:wifi开发 wifi开发通常涉及到wifi模块的控制、wifi网络的连接和管理、wifi安全机制等方面。在Android平台上进行wifi开发,除了需要理解Android的wifi框架,还需要了解 wifi协议、wifi设备的工作原理等知识。

相关推荐